@charset "utf-8";
/* CSS Document */

/*

Clients Section

*/


.textposition
{
font-family:Arial, Helvetica, sans-serif;
font-size:11px;
}



body
{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
margin:0;
padding:0;
background:url(../images/bg_image_blog.jpg) repeat-x;
}


#bannerabout
{
	width:910px;
	height:136px;
	float:left;
	padding:0;
	margin:0;
	background:url(../images/banner_img_blog.jpg) no-repeat;
}

#clientcontent
{
width:661px;
height:800px;
float:left;
color:#666666;
padding-top:23px;
}

.clientscontainer
{
width:609px;
height:287px;
float:left;
margin-bottom:46px;
border-bottom:#CCCCCC 1px dashed;
}

.clientscontainertop
{
width:609px;
height:123px;
float:left;
}

.clientslogo
{
width:123px;
height:123px;
float:left;
}

.clientsinfo
{
width:470px;
height:82px;
float:left;
padding-left:15px;
padding-top:15px;
}


ul#clientsquestion
{
width:43px;
height:80px;
float:left;
display:block;
padding:0;
margin:0;
}

ul#clientsquestion li
{
height:20px;
}

ul#clientsinfos
{
width:273px;
height:80px;
float:left;
display:block;
padding:0;
margin:0;
font-family:Arial, Helvetica, sans-serif;
font-weight:bold;
}

ul#clientsinfos li
{
height:20px;
width:273px;
display:block;
}



.clientsmessage
{
width:586px;
float:left;
margin-top:28px;
padding-left:23px;
background:url(../images/quotationmark1.jpg) no-repeat;
line-height:25px;
font-size:11px;
}



#aboutbtn
{
width:242px;
padding-top:20px;
float:left;
}



ul#navabout
{
margin:0;
padding:0;
float:right;
width:242px;
}

ul#navabout li
{
display:block;
margin:0;
padding:0;
width:242px;
}

ul#navabout li a
{
padding:0;
margin:0;
display:block;
height:49px;
text-indent:-9999px;
}

ul#navabout li.companyprofile a
{
background:url(../images/companyprofile_btn.jpg) bottom center no-repeat;
width:242px;
}

ul#navabout li.companyprofiles a
{
background:url(../images/companyprofile_btn.jpg) top no-repeat;
width:242px;
}

ul#navabout li.testimonials a
{
background:url(../images/testimonials_btn.jpg) bottom center no-repeat;
width:242px;
}

ul#navabout li.testimonialss a
{
background:url(../images/testimonials_btn.jpg) top no-repeat;
width:242px;
}

ul#navabout li.steps a
{
background:url(../images/steps_btn.jpg) bottom center no-repeat;
width:242px;
}

ul#navabout li.stepss a
{
background:url(../images/steps_btn.jpg) top no-repeat;
width:242px;
}



ul#navabout li a:hover
{
background-position:center center;
}




#services
{
float:left;
padding-top:20px;
padding-left:26px;
margin:0;
width:214px;

}

#services h3
{
text-indent:-9999px;
background:url(../images/services_header.jpg) no-repeat;
height:44px;
margin:0;
padding-bottom:20px;

}


ul#serviceslists
{
width:214px;
padding:0;
margin:0;
}

ul#serviceslists li
{
height:25px;
padding-left:20px;
}

ul#serviceslists li a
{
color:#666666;
}

ul#serviceslists li a:hover
{
text-decoration:underline;
}



#place
{
float:left;
padding-top:20px;
padding-left:26px;
margin:0;
width:214px;

}

#place h3
{
text-indent:-9999px;
background:url(../images/places_header.jpg) no-repeat;
height:44px;
margin:0;
padding-bottom:20px;

}


ul#placelists
{
width:214px;
padding:0;
margin:0;
}

ul#placelists li
{
height:25px;
padding-left:20px;
}

ul#placelists li a
{
color:#666666;
}

ul#placelists li a:hover
{
text-decoration:underline;
}



















.postnumbers
{
width:570px;
height:20px;
float:left;
padding-left:38px;
padding-top:30px;
margin:0;
}

.pages
{
float:left;
}

.numbers
{
float:right;
border: 1px solid #bbbbbb;
padding: 0.2em 0.4em 0.3em 0.4em;
margin:0;
color:#339900;
margin-left:3px;
}

.numbers a
{
color:#333333;
}

.numbers a:hover
{
color:#339900;
}
